Any one have any experience or suggestions for protecting a 50 X 100 flat roof.



Photo beams or motions are not really suitable.



Looking for leaky coax or some other form of proximity sensors or ?



Any ideas?

I've used their stress sensors on boats. Never had a problem with them. They take some time to adjust for sensitivity. I can imagine that on a flat roof, accumlating water, snow etc, could be a fluctuation that couldn't be accommodated by sensitivity adjustment. You can call and ask. I think the owner is still Austin Stack. It's a relatively small company but it's been around for a looooong time.

I have used them on decks and roofs with little problem great little problem solver.

In the past I have also used them. They only react to major weight change so rain snow should be ok
